Suzanna Leigh (born Suzanna Smyth on July 26, 1945 in the Belgrave, Leicester) was an English actress. She is best remembered by North American audiences as the love interest of Elvis Presley in the 1966 motion picture, Paradise, Hawaiian Style, and as the frail heroine in a couple of Hammer-films: The Lost Continent (1968) and Lust for a Vampire (1971).
